Reducing stress 

When you are in severe pain, your blood pressure and heart rate increase which negatively impacts the healing process. However, a pain management service will help you win, easing your suffering and thereby reducing the amount of stress you face due to the discomfort.

Continuous pain can become a factor in low mood, frustration, and anxiety. You will feel irritated and have less energy to perform any activities or indulge in any activities. But when you focus on pain management and follow precautions and remedies suggested by medical professionals, you will slowly be able to improve the functioning of your body and relieve the over-strain in any part of your body.
